From 0b3aa81b31a6047a207289493acaa0faa02d873b Mon Sep 17 00:00:00 2001 From: Krzysztof Pawlik Date: Sat, 22 Jul 2006 22:41:34 +0000 Subject: Migrated to Generation 2. (Portage version: 2.1.1_pre3-r3) --- dev-java/commons-discovery/ChangeLog | 10 +++- .../commons-discovery-0.2-r3.ebuild | 55 ++++++++++++++++++++++ .../files/digest-commons-discovery-0.2-r2 | 2 + .../files/digest-commons-discovery-0.2-r3 | 3 ++ 4 files changed, 68 insertions(+), 2 deletions(-) create mode 100644 dev-java/commons-discovery/commons-discovery-0.2-r3.ebuild create mode 100644 dev-java/commons-discovery/files/digest-commons-discovery-0.2-r3 (limited to 'dev-java/commons-discovery') diff --git a/dev-java/commons-discovery/ChangeLog b/dev-java/commons-discovery/ChangeLog index 63a7a451cf07..f2fd3a5c675e 100644 --- a/dev-java/commons-discovery/ChangeLog +++ b/dev-java/commons-discovery/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for dev-java/commons-discovery -# Copyright 2000-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-java/commons-discovery/ChangeLog,v 1.14 2005/10/21 14:52:12 betelgeuse Exp $ +#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/dev-java/commons-discovery/ChangeLog,v 1.15 2006/07/22 22:41:34 nelchael Exp $ + +*commons-discovery-0.2-r3 (22 Jul 2006) + + 22 Jul 2006; Krzysiek Pawlik + +commons-discovery-0.2-r3.ebuild: + Migrated to Generation 2. 21 Oct 2005; Petteri Räty commons-discovery-0.2-r2.ebuild: diff --git a/dev-java/commons-discovery/commons-discovery-0.2-r3.ebuild b/dev-java/commons-discovery/commons-discovery-0.2-r3.ebuild new file mode 100644 index 000000000000..3d9f90800f36 --- /dev/null +++ b/dev-java/commons-discovery/commons-discovery-0.2-r3.ebuild @@ -0,0 +1,55 @@ +# Copyright 1999-2006 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-java/commons-discovery/commons-discovery-0.2-r3.ebuild,v 1.1 2006/07/22 22:41:34 nelchael Exp $ + +inherit java-pkg-2 java-ant-2 eutils + +DESCRIPTION="Commons Discovery: Service Discovery component" +HOMEPAGE="http://jakarta.apache.org/commons/discovery" +SRC_URI="mirror://apache/jakarta/commons/discovery/source/${P}-src.tar.gz" + +LICENSE="Apache-2.0" +SLOT="0" +KEYWORDS="~amd64 ~ppc ~sparc ~x86" +IUSE="source junit doc" + +RDEPEND=">=virtual/jre-1.4 + dev-java/commons-logging" + +DEPEND=">=virtual/jdk-1.4 + ${RDEPEND} + dev-java/ant-core + source? ( app-arch/zip ) + junit? ( >=dev-java/junit-3.8 )" + +S="${WORKDIR}/${P}-src/discovery" + +src_unpack() { + unpack ${A} + cd ${S} + + chmod u+w ${S}/../discovery + epatch ${FILESDIR}/${P}-gentoo.diff + + mkdir -p ${S}/target/lib && cd ${S}/target/lib + use junit && java-pkg_jar-from junit junit.jar + java-pkg_jar-from commons-logging +} + +src_compile() { + local antflags="dist" + use doc && antflags="${antflags} javadoc" + use junit && antflags="${antflags} test.discovery" + eant ${antflags} || die "compile problem" +} + +src_install() { + java-pkg_dojar dist/${PN}.jar + + if use doc; then + java-pkg_dohtml PROPOSAL.html STATUS.html usersguide.html + java-pkg_dohtml -r ${S}/dist/docs/api + fi + + use source && java-pkg_dosrc ${S}/src/java/* +} diff --git a/dev-java/commons-discovery/files/digest-commons-discovery-0.2-r2 b/dev-java/commons-discovery/files/digest-commons-discovery-0.2-r2 index 2db042643727..21902d5ae390 100644 --- a/dev-java/commons-discovery/files/digest-commons-discovery-0.2-r2 +++ b/dev-java/commons-discovery/files/digest-commons-discovery-0.2-r2 @@ -1 +1,3 @@ MD5 57968a150ea9b7158ac0e995c8f24080 commons-discovery-0.2-src.tar.gz 72783 +RMD160 521a0439dd8f92d44dcf434abc0e3b6681c38048 commons-discovery-0.2-src.tar.gz 72783 +SHA256 4c3d87c991ae2079a71b428077b1276de4fc68d7b5dd2bc2f6e084b3f286f22a commons-discovery-0.2-src.tar.gz 72783 diff --git a/dev-java/commons-discovery/files/digest-commons-discovery-0.2-r3 b/dev-java/commons-discovery/files/digest-commons-discovery-0.2-r3 new file mode 100644 index 000000000000..21902d5ae390 --- /dev/null +++ b/dev-java/commons-discovery/files/digest-commons-discovery-0.2-r3 @@ -0,0 +1,3 @@ +MD5 57968a150ea9b7158ac0e995c8f24080 commons-discovery-0.2-src.tar.gz 72783 +RMD160 521a0439dd8f92d44dcf434abc0e3b6681c38048 commons-discovery-0.2-src.tar.gz 72783 +SHA256 4c3d87c991ae2079a71b428077b1276de4fc68d7b5dd2bc2f6e084b3f286f22a commons-discovery-0.2-src.tar.gz 72783 -- cgit v1.2.3-65-gdbad